Definition
Mincingly means in a careful or affected manner, often characterized by delicacy or precision in movement or speech.

Mincingly sentence examples
- She walked mincingly across the room, careful not to disturb the carefully arranged flowers.
- His voice was almost mincingly polite, masking the frustration beneath.
- The waiter approached the table mincingly, balancing the plates with an air of precision.
- In a mincingly exaggerated manner, he acted out the ridiculous story he had just heard.
- Every step she took was mincingly measured, as if she were afraid of making any noise.
